Where and how people live — the homes, how they are held, and what they cost.
A far higher share of homes are owned outright in The Marra than across Australia, where 50% of residents own their place without a mortgage. This sparsely populated area is almost entirely made up of large, detached houses.

Rents, mortgages and crowding.
Typical weekly rent is just $150, which is far below the national figure of $375. However, those with home loans face a typical monthly payment of $2,167, which is a little above the Australian figure.

How homes are owned or rented.
Half of the households here are owned outright, far above the 31% seen nationally. In a striking contrast to the rest of the state, no one in The Marra is renting.

Houses, townhouses, apartments and bedrooms.
Every single home in the area is a separate house, and 95.8% have three or more bedrooms. This is far above the national figure of 73.8%, with 25% of homes having five or more bedrooms.
